use crate::{
client::FinnhubClient,
error::Result,
models::{crypto::*, stock::CandleResolution},
};
pub struct CryptoEndpoints<'a> {
client: &'a FinnhubClient,
}
impl<'a> CryptoEndpoints<'a> {
pub fn new(client: &'a FinnhubClient) -> Self {
Self { client }
}
pub async fn exchanges(&self) -> Result<Vec<CryptoExchange>> {
self.client.get("/crypto/exchange").await
}
pub async fn symbols(&self, exchange: &str) -> Result<Vec<CryptoSymbol>> {
self.client
.get(&format!("/crypto/symbol?exchange={}", exchange))
.await
}
pub async fn candles(
&self,
symbol: &str,
resolution: CandleResolution,
from: i64,
to: i64,
) -> Result<CryptoCandles> {
self.client
.get(&format!(
"/crypto/candle?symbol={}&resolution={}&from={}&to={}",
symbol, resolution, from, to
))
.await
}
pub async fn profile(&self, symbol: &str) -> Result<CryptoProfile> {
self.client
.get(&format!("/crypto/profile?symbol={}", symbol))
.await
}
}
